Slow-smoked pork shoulder, usually chopped or pulled and dressed with a tangy vinegar-based sauce. It is a signature Carolinas barbecue style widely loved in Charlotte.
Pork shoulder smoked over hardwood and served with a red slaw seasoned with barbecue dip. This Piedmont North Carolina tradition is common around Charlotte.
Crisp, seasoned chicken with deep Southern roots, often served with biscuits and sides. It is a staple comfort food across Charlotte and the Carolinas.

Moderate by U.S. standards. Hotels vary, while casual dining, coffee, and local transport are fairly manageable for most visitors.
Tip 18-20% at restaurants; 20%+ for great service. Tip bartenders USD 1-2 per drink, taxis 10-15%, hotel staff a few USD, and round up for casual services.
